There's an alternate ending coming on the DVD.

 

Also, there were 18 MINUTES cut from the finale which include some of these scenes:

-Robin Sparkles performing at the wedding with the Robot

-A lunch with Ted/Robin that puts the ending in "better" context

-More on #31 and Barney

-More on the Mother's illness

-The Pineapple explained

One of the deleted scenes from the final episode appears to have been a montage of Ted and the Mother's funeral

 

 

Hannigan also believes that showing Ted mourning his wife would have helped ease fan frustration for those who felt The Mother was killed off too quickly.

 
"‘Oh, [Ted] mourned. He got closure’ — and then they’d be happy that [he and Robin] got together," Hannigan said. "Rather than be like, ‘Oh, wait. She died? What? They’re together, huh?’ And credits. That’s what I think was too fast.”
